New location for Casey’s
TRANSFORMATION AT JUNCTION 9-75 In early February, Junction 9-75 convenience store will close. Casey’s is buying the store and will move to its new location in early February. When the new location opens, the current Casey’s location at 709 First Ave. will close. (Photo/Dominique Kooiker)Dominique Kooiker | EditorThe junction of highways 9 and 75 in […]

First snowstorm of the season sweeps across Lyon County
Dominique Kooiker | Editor The first major snowstorm of the 2023-24 winter season swept through northwest Iowa Monday, Jan. 8 into the early morning hours of Tuesday, Jan. 9. Snowfall rates during the storm ranged upwards of 1 to 2 inches per hour. Rapid accumulation of 4 to 8 inches of snow was reported throughout […]
